Meeder Asset Management Inc. lessened its holdings in United Bankshares, Inc. (NASDAQ:UBSI – Free Report) by 33.6%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 30,317 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 15,342 shares during the period. Meeder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in United Bankshares were worth $1,256,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

United Bankshares (NASDAQ:UBSI –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 23rd. The financial services provider reported $0.89 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.85 by $0.04. The firm had revenue of $316.58 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$315.15 million. United Bankshares had a net margin of 27.45% and a return on equity of 9.26%.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$0.59 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ts forecast that United Bankshares, Inc. will post 3.64 EPS for the current year.
United Bankshares Announces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, July 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, June 12th were issued a dividend of $0.38 per share. This represents a $1.52 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.2%. The ex-dividend date was Friday, June 12th. United Bankshares’s dividend payout ratio is presently 42.58%.
About United Bankshares
United Bankshares, Inc, headquartered in Charleston, West Virginia, is a bank holding company that provides a full range of financial services through its primary subsidiary, United Bank. The company’s core offerings include retail and commercial banking products such as checking and savings accounts, certificates of deposit, personal and business loans, mortgages, and treasury management services. In addition, United Bankshares delivers private banking, wealth management, trust and fiduciary solutions, and investment advisory services to meet the needs of individual, corporate, and institutional clients.
United Bankshares operates an extensive branch network across West Virginia, Virginia, Maryland, the District of Columbia, Ohio, Pennsylvania, and South Carolina.
